Understanding Tire Puncture Mechanics
A tire repair plug works by filling the void created by a puncturing object, such as a nail or screw. The plug material, typically a flexible rubber compound reinforced with fibers, is pushed through the tire casing. As it's inserted, it expands within the puncture channel. Once in place, the surrounding tire material and a sealant often applied to the plug help create an airtight bond. This mechanism is critical for preventing air loss and maintaining tire pressure. While often referred to as temporary, a well-executed plug repair can last the life of the tire, much like a patch from the inside.
When to Trust a Tire Plug
The primary consideration involves the location and size of the puncture. Tire repair plugs are most effective for punctures in the tread area that are relatively straight and smaller than 1/4 inch in diameter. This is because the plug needs sufficient casing material around it to create a strong, airtight seal. Limitations and Risks
However, plugs are not a universal solution. Punctures in the tire's sidewall or shoulder are generally not repairable with plugs (or any other method) because these areas flex excessively during operation. This constant movement would compromise the plug's seal, leading to leaks or even blowouts. Likewise, multiple punctures close together or very large gashes exceed the capabilities of standard plug kits. Choosing the Right Tire Repair Plug Kit
When selecting a tire repair plug kit, several components are essential for a successful repair. Most kits include a reamer tool (to clean and enlarge the puncture channel), an insertion tool (often a split-eye needle), and the repair plugs themselves. Look for plugs made from durable, high-quality rubber that can withstand tire flexing and temperature changes. Some advanced kits might include a sealant or a small bottle of tire lubricant to aid insertion.

Step-by-Step Plug Installation
Successfully using tire repair plugs involves a methodical approach. First, locate the puncture and remove the puncturing object carefully. Next, use the reamer tool to clean and slightly enlarge the puncture channel, ensuring a smooth passage for the plug. Apply a small amount of lubricant to the plug and thread it through the eye of the insertion tool, leaving about half of the plug exposed. Firmly push the insertion tool with the plug into the tire until only about an inch remains outside. Withdraw the insertion tool straight out, leaving the plug embedded in the tire. Trim any excess plug material flush with the tread.
Always check your tire for other punctures after repairing one, as multiple nails can sometimes enter the same tire.

After installation, it is imperative to acknowledge that the tire must be re-inflated to the correct pressure, typically the PSI listed on the driver's side doorjamb sticker, not the maximum pressure listed on the tire sidewall itself. Then, meticulously inspect the repaired area for any signs of air leakage by listening closely and applying a soapy water solution, which will reveal bubbles if a leak is present. Factors Influencing Plug Longevity
The lifespan of a tire repair plug depends on several key factors. The quality of the plug material, the precision of the installation, and the tire's overall condition play significant roles. A plug installed correctly in a healthy tire, in the appropriate tread location, can indeed last for thousands of miles, often matching the remaining life of the tire. However, factors like aggressive driving, improper inflation, or the presence of internal tire damage can shorten its effective life. Maintaining Tire Integrity Post-Repair
Regular checks are vital after a plug repair. Monitor your tire pressure more frequently, especially during the first few days and weeks. Avoid exceeding the speed and load ratings specified for your tires. If you notice any subtle vibration, uneven wear, or recurring pressure loss, these are signs that the plug may be failing or that there's underlying damage. When Professional Intervention is Necessary
Despite the convenience of tire repair plugs, they are not a substitute for professional tire service in all cases. If the puncture is larger than 1/4 inch, is located in the sidewall or shoulder, or if there are multiple punctures in the same area, you must seek professional assistance. A professional repair typically involves dismounting the tire and applying a patch-and-plug combination from the inside, which is considered the safest and most durable method for most punctures.
